11. Never EVER go gawking after a bomb goes off |
|
It is a common practice to use a smaller bomb to cause a building to be evacuated and/or attract gawkers before using a larger bomb to kill lots of people.
It's even printed in the US Army Field Manuals as a guerrilla warfare tactic.
And it's what The Olympic Park Bomber did when he bombed an abortion clinic.
He put the second explosive device next to where he new people would be standing after they evacuated the building.
If a bomb goes off somewhere, don't mosey over there to look at the damage.
If a bomb goes off in your building, don't linger at the standard "rallying point." Find somewhere else to be.
